NATO on Georgia’s Elections

NATO has welcomed the January 5 presidential election in Georgia, saying it was “an important step in Georgia’s democratic development”, and promised to deepen its Intensified Dialogue (ID) with Georgia.   


“We welcome the initial evaluation of the conduct of presidential elections in Georgia, which indicated that this was a viable expression of the free choice of the Georgian people,” James Appathurai, NATO spokesman, said on January 8.
 
He also stressed that all irregularities identified by international observers should be addressed before parliamentary elections expected this spring. 


“NATO will continue to deepen its Intensified Dialogue with Georgia, and support further efforts to meet Euro-Atlantic standards,” the NATO spokesman said.
